Mainnet: The Real Deal
Mainnet refers to the main blockchain network of a cryptocurrency or decentralized platform where actual transactions occur, and real assets are exchanged. It represents the live version of the blockchain, operating with real economic value and consensus mechanisms. Mainnet is the ultimate destination for DApps and users looking to engage in genuine transactions and interact with the decentralized ecosystem.
Mainnet provides users with access to real-world applications and services built on the blockchain. These applications encompass various sectors such as finance, gaming, healthcare, supply chain management, and more. Users can utilize decentralized applications (DApps) on the mainnet to perform financial transactions, access decentralized finance (DeFi) services, play games, or interact with other digital assets. Mainnet enables users to have full ownership and control over their digital assets and transactions. Through private keys and wallet addresses, users can securely manage their assets, transfer funds, and participate in various activities within the decentralized ecosystem without relying on intermediaries or third parties.

All cryptocurrency projects have one thing in common, the use of blockchain as a means of keeping track of transactions. However, not all cryptocurrency projects need to have a blockchain of their own for that project or mainnet. For example, many cryptocurrencies are nothing more than tokens created on other blockchains. This is because creating and maintaining a blockchain can be complicated, time-consuming, and expensive (if you want to have good performance, security, and decentralization). However, some projects that have blockchains with different characteristics as a competitive advantage do bet on having their own blockchain. Typically, these projects end up being bigger and more successful.

Key Characteristics of Mainnet
Mainnet facilitates actual transactions involving native tokens or digital assets. These transactions are recorded on the immutable blockchain ledger and are irreversible once confirmed. Mainnet tokens possess real economic value and can be traded on cryptocurrency exchanges. Users can buy, sell, and transfer tokens freely within the network.
It is considered the production environment where blockchain networks operate at scale, serving real-world applications and users. Mainnet undergoes rigorous testing and security audits to ensure stability, security, and reliability. Any changes or upgrades to the mainnet require careful consideration and consensus among network participants.
Testnet: A Sandbox for Development and Testing
Testnet, on the other hand, serves as a parallel blockchain network designed for testing, experimentation, and development purposes. It mimics the mainnet environment but operates with test tokens or “fake” cryptocurrency, allowing developers to test DApps, smart contracts, and network upgrades without risking real assets. Testnet provides a safe and controlled environment for debugging code, identifying vulnerabilities, and validating new features before deploying them to the mainnet.
It is a dedicated environment for developers to develop, test, and debug their blockchain applications and smart contracts. By deploying applications on the testnet, developers can validate their code, simulate real-world scenarios, and identify potential issues or vulnerabilities before deploying to the mainnet. Testnet fosters community engagement and collaboration among developers, users, and stakeholders. Developers can engage with the community, solicit feedback, address concerns, and build relationships with early adopters, fostering a sense of ownership and involvement in the development process.

Key Characteristics of Testnet
Testnet replicates the mainnet environment using test tokens or coins that have no real-world value. These tokens are freely available for testing purposes and can be acquired from faucet services.
It is designed to encourage experimentation and innovation by providing developers with a sandbox environment to test new features, upgrades, and protocols without consequences.
Testnet relies on community participation and feedback to identify bugs, enhance performance, and ensure the reliability of blockchain networks before they are deployed to the mainnet. It facilitates rapid iteration and iteration cycles, allowing developers to deploy and test changes quickly without impacting the stability of the mainnet. This agile development approach accelerates innovation and improves the overall quality of blockchain projects.
Differences Between Mainnet and Testnet
Mainnet facilitates real transactions involving actual assets, while testnet operates with simulated transactions using test tokens or coins.
Mainnet tokens have real economic value and can be traded on cryptocurrency exchanges, whereas testnet tokens have no intrinsic value and are used solely for testing purposes.
Mainnet undergoes rigorous testing and security audits to ensure stability and security, while testnet is more prone to bugs and vulnerabilities due to its experimental nature.
Mainnet engages a broader community of users and stakeholders, while testnet relies on developers and enthusiasts for testing, feedback, and improvement.
